## Changelog — StockMender v2.4

Heads up, newcomers: we renamed `RECON_JOB_KEY` to `INVENTORY_RECON_TOKEN` because the old name confused everyone into thinking it was the cron schedule key. The nightly reconciliation job at Harlow Mercantile now reads the new name exclusively — no fallback, so stale env files will fail loudly at startup. Update your local `.env` before running the job, or you'll get a cryptic auth error from the warehouse sync. Add this line to your env file:

env line for taduf-fajef: COURIER_KEY5=4d295

Priority: High. The Corvalen event schema registry incorrectly flags enum value additions as breaking changes, blocking producer deploys even when consumers tolerate unknown values. Root cause appears to be the compatibility checker treating enums as closed sets regardless of the declared policy. For the release manager: this blocks three teams from publishing this cycle, so we recommend pulling the checker fix into the patch train. Verification should be done against the build noted below.

pipeline stamp: htk31_f769b577b3028a4e9958e5bb8d1259a

Heads up for the sync: we renamed a setting in the Tidemark upload pipeline. The encoding detector used to read CHARSNIFF_KEY, which was confusingly similar to the cache key prefix, so as of this week it's CHARSNIFF_API_SECRET. The old variable still works until the next minor release, but the deprecation warning is noisy, so please migrate your local setups now. Detection accuracy and the fallback-to-UTF-8 behavior are unchanged. To update, open the detector's .env and add the following line:

secret setting of hawep-yahig: LEDGER_TOKEN29=41b5d6315371c92885eaeb077fb63